Exploring the Role of Technology in Education

What Does Technology Mean in Education?

In education, technology is a broad term that includes a variety of tools, methods, and practices aimed at enhancing teaching and learning. For New Zealand’s tertiary sector, this involves using digital platforms, software, and devices to improve both instruction and the learning experience. The applications are diverse, spanning vocational training, adult community education, and traditional academic settings.

In vocational education, technology offers the potential of practical training through features like simulations, virtual labs, and interactive tutorials. In the realm of adult community education, technology can facilitate the creation of user-friendly, community-focused platforms that encourage lifelong learning. Within academic settings, technology often takes the form of research tools, online databases, learning management systems, and more.

Digital Literacy: More Than Just Technical Skills

Digital literacy goes beyond simply knowing how to use a computer; it’s about understanding how to navigate, assess, and produce information using digital tools. This skill set extends past mere technical proficiency to encompass critical thinking, problem-solving, teamwork, and digital ethics.

For educators in various sectors—whether working with new migrants, in trades, vocational training, or universities—digital literacy is a crucial element of modern teaching and learning. It equips educators to create relevant, engaging, and accessible content, while also enabling learners to thrive in a digitally interconnected world.

Whakapapa: The Evolution of Technology in Education

The journey of technology in New Zealand’s educational landscape has been both progressive and unique, echoing global advancements while adapting them to local needs. From the early days of computer labs and educational CD-ROMs to the current era of interactive whiteboards, virtual reality, and AI-driven tools, technology’s role has consistently evolved.

The 1990s marked the arrival of internet access in educational settings, laying the foundation for online learning. The 2000s saw the emergence of learning management systems and the proliferation of mobile devices. More recently, there’s been a rise in personalised learning, virtual classrooms, and intelligent adaptive systems. These developments have been responsive to the changing demands of tertiary education, encompassing vocational training, community education, and academic sectors.

Understanding AI Technology and Tools

The Fundamentals of AI in Education

Artificial Intelligence (AI) is making significant strides in education worldwide, and New Zealand’s tertiary sector is no exception. Simply put, AI mimics human intelligence in machines, capable of learning, reasoning, and adapting to new situations.

In educational settings, AI’s utility spans various contexts, from vocational and community-based to academic. It offers the ability to personalise learning, streamline administrative tasks, give real-time feedback, and even create more inclusive learning spaces. For tertiary educators, understanding AI doesn’t mean delving into complex algorithms; it’s about recognising how AI can be a valuable asset in achieving educational objectives.

AI-Powered Tools: Practical Applications for Tertiary Educators

AI-powered tools are applications that leverage machine learning and other AI techniques to accomplish specific tasks. These tools offer distinct advantages for tertiary educators in New Zealand.

Chat GPT: This text-based AI tool can engage students in dialogue, offer immediate feedback, support personalised learning, and even assist with content creation. It’s particularly useful in vocational training for simulations and in academic settings for research assistance.

Adaptive Learning Platforms: These platforms modify the learning path and materials based on each student’s performance and needs. This enhances personalised learning experiences and is especially relevant in adult community education, where learner needs can vary widely.

AI-Based Assessment Systems: It’s still early days, but these may prove particularly useful in trades and vocational training. They offer real-time evaluation and grading, freeing up educators’ time and providing more consistent and immediate feedback.

Applications in Educational Settings: Tailoring AI to Diverse Needs

The scope for AI’s practical application in New Zealand’s educational sectors is extensive:

Vocational Education: AI can create realistic simulations for trades training, offering immersive experiences without requiring physical resources. It’s also useful for monitoring student progress and pinpointing areas that need attention.

Adult Community Education: For those teaching adult learners, AI can provide personalised learning paths, making education more accessible and engaging. It also supports remote learning, accommodating a range of needs and life situations.

Academic Tertiary Education: Within universities and polytechnics, AI can assist in research, streamline administrative tasks, analyse large data sets for trend identification, and even provide personalised tutoring beyond standard classroom hours.

Ethical Considerations in Technology Usage: Navigating the Moral Landscape

The incorporation of technology, especially AI, into New Zealand’s tertiary education sector, comes with its own set of ethical considerations. Using these technologies demands the highest level of care and responsibility to ensure they align with both legal requirements and ethical norms. Let’s look at some of the issues. 

Privacy Concerns: Safeguarding Personal Data

In adult and community education settings, the management of personal data is particularly critical. Educators, administrators, and tech providers must adhere to responsible data collection and usage practices, which include:

Transparency: Clearly informing students and participants about what data is being collected and why.

Consent: Gaining explicit approval, especially when dealing with sensitive or personal information.

Protection: Implementing strong safeguards to prevent unauthorised access and misuse of data.

Data Security: A Priority Across Educational Settings

In educational environments ranging from vocational training centres to universities, data security is of the utmost importance. Suitable measures for these diverse contexts include:

Encryption: Making sure that sensitive information is encrypted and securely transmitted.

Access Controls: Putting in place strict access controls to limit unauthorised entry.

Regular Audits: Carrying out frequent security audits to identify and address vulnerabilities.

Digital Citizenship: Fostering Responsible Online Behaviour

Instilling responsible online behaviour is a responsibility that spans all areas of tertiary education. This entails:

Understanding Rights and Responsibilities: Educators should help students become aware of their digital rights and responsibilities.

Promoting Ethical Behaviour: This includes encouraging ethical conduct online, such as respecting intellectual property and privacy, as well as fostering inclusivity.

Providing Guidance and Support: Resources and support should be made available to cultivate responsible digital citizenship, tailored to the needs of diverse learners, whether they are new migrants, vocational trainees, or academic scholars.

Legal and Regulatory Compliance: Navigating the Legal Framework

Adherence to New Zealand’s education laws and regulations is a fundamental requirement for all involved in the tertiary education sector. Key areas of focus may include:

Data Protection Laws: Compliance with rules governing the collection, storage, and use of personal data is essential.

Accessibility Standards: Technology deployed must meet accessibility standards to foster an inclusive educational setting.

Education Acts and Regulations: Educators and administrators should be well-versed in specific laws concerning educational standards, assessments, quality assurance, and other relevant areas.

The Intersection of Technology and Māori Educational Values: A Balanced Approach

In New Zealand’s tertiary education sector, aligning technology use with Māori educational values is essential. Adopting technology isn’t just about utilising the latest tools; it’s also about incorporating principles that align with Māori worldviews.

Cultural Responsiveness: Beyond Mere Acknowledgement

Incorporating Māori cultural elements into tertiary education goes beyond mere recognition; it’s about creating learning spaces where Māori values are both integrated and respected. This involves:

Tailored Content: Crafting content that acknowledges and incorporates Māori history, language, and culture.

Collaboration with Māori Communities: Engaging closely with Māori communities to understand their unique needs and viewpoints.

Inclusive Design: Utilising technology to develop learning experiences that are both inclusive and reflective of Māori cultural values.

Promoting Whanaungatanga (Building Relationships): Leveraging Technology for Connection

The principle of Whanaungatanga, centred on relationship-building, can be enhanced through technology across diverse educational settings:

Virtual Marae: Establishing virtual spaces that nurture a sense of community and connection.

Collaborative Learning Platforms: Employing tools that encourage collaboration and engagement among learners, educators, and communities.

Support for Remote Areas: Utilising technology to close geographical divides, strengthening connections between urban and rural settings, including marae training centres and vocational training facilities.

Technology and Manaakitanga (Care and Respect): Thoughtful Integration Across Education

Aligning technology with the value of Manaakitanga, which encapsulates care and respect, necessitates careful planning across various educational contexts:

Accessibility: Making sure that educational tools and platforms are accessible to all, honouring individual needs and preferences.

Ethical Considerations: Deploying technology in a manner that respects individual privacy and community values.

Supportive Environments: Using technology to craft nurturing and supportive educational experiences, tailored to the needs of diverse learners, whether they are involved in adult community education, trades and vocational training, or academic tertiary education.

Challenges and Opportunities: Navigating the Evolving Landscape

As technology increasingly becomes a part of New Zealand’s tertiary education sector, it presents both challenges and opportunities. These factors require careful consideration by educators across vocational, community, and academic settings to fully leverage the potential of technology.

Potential Challenges: Barriers to Effective Technology Integration

Successfully implementing technology in tertiary education involves understanding and addressing various challenges:

Resistance to Change: In traditional or under-resourced settings, there may be reluctance from educators or institutions to embrace new technologies.

Accessibility Issues: Providing equal access to technology for all students, including those with disabilities or in remote locations, presents a significant challenge.

Technological Barriers: Factors such as insufficient infrastructure, outdated equipment, or a lack of technical skills can impede the effective use of technology.

Cultural Sensitivity: Thoughtful planning is required to balance technological advancements with respect for cultural values, including those of Māori and Pacific communities.

Opportunities for Innovation and Enhancement: Unlocking Technology’s Potential

Despite the challenges, technology presents significant opportunities for enriching and innovating tertiary education in New Zealand:

Personalised Learning: AI and machine learning technologies can offer tailored learning experiences, adapting to each learner’s needs and pace.

Collaboration and Engagement: Platforms that encourage collaboration can enhance engagement and community building, in line with the principle of Whanaungatanga (relationship building).

Enhancing Inclusivity: Assistive technologies can create unprecedented access and opportunities for a diverse range of learners, resonating with the values of Manaakitanga (care and respect).

Driving Research and Development: The use of technology can spur research, innovation, and development across various educational fields, encouraging a culture of ongoing growth and exploration.

Future Perspectives: A Closer Look at Emerging Technologies

The future of technology in New Zealand’s tertiary education sector is promising, with several emerging trends poised to make a significant impact:

Virtual and Augmented Reality: These technologies can offer immersive learning experiences that are especially beneficial in vocational training. For example, virtual reality could simulate a construction site, allowing trainees to practice safety protocols in a risk-free environment. Augmented reality could overlay digital information onto physical objects, like machinery, to provide real-time guidance and troubleshooting.

Blockchain in Education: Blockchain technology can ensure data integrity and facilitate secure, transparent credentialing processes. For instance, academic certificates could be stored on a blockchain, making it easier for employers to verify qualifications without going through lengthy verification processes.

Internet of Things (IoT): The connectivity of devices and systems can create integrated, intelligent learning environments. For example, in a university setting, IoT could be used to monitor and optimise energy usage in real-time, or in a vocational training centre, IoT sensors could provide immediate feedback on the performance of mechanical systems, allowing for timely adjustments.

These emerging technologies offer new avenues for educational innovation, enhancing both the teaching and learning experience across vocational, community, and academic settings.
